Montco Girl Dies At 19, Thousands Raised To Support Family

The community is gathering to support a local family after an unimaginable tragedy.

TELFORD, PA — Friends and family are mourning a Montgomery County teenager who died in November, and thousands have been raised in an effort to support her loved ones.

Juliette Birchet was 19 when she died on Friday, Nov. 21. Her family said she died suddenly.

Birchet attended Souderton Area High School and had graduated from North Montco Technical Career Center with the class of 2025.

"Juliette was a bright, joyful soul who had a gift for making others feel seen, loved, and understood," Abby and Jenna Birchet wrote in the GoFundMe. "Her laughter filled every room, her kindness touched every person she met, and her spirit brought warmth into our lives in a way that can never be replaced."

Her obituary echoed this spirit.

"Juliette was an avid gamer and micro-influencer who will be remembered as a fashion icon and spirited Queen!"the obituary notes.

A total of nearly $9,000 had been raised as of Friday morning through the GoFundMe, with 220 different people donating. To learn more, see the fundraiser online here.
